Repeat the test again and again,some phones are crashed. our analysis: We analyze ten kernel-dumps,we found something common kernel is blocked. pasre in crash,all the dump are directed to usb(device port/hub). here is a kdump,task 446 &365&4511 are UN. 446: .... ->|kobj_attr_store |state_store |pm_suspend |enter_state |suspend_devices_and_enter |dpm_resume_end |dpm_resume |dpm_resume |async_synchronize_full |async_synchronize_cookie_domain |schedule 446 is waiting for 365&4511,no doubtful usb thread. here is some warning log: [83.958310] musb device disconnect detected from VBUS GPIO. .......... [84.908017] musb device connection detected from VBUS GPIO. [84.911946] typec port1-partner: parent port1 should not be sleeping task 365 & 4511: ... ->worker_thread |process_one_work |async_run_entry_fn |async_resume |device_resume |dpm_wait_for_superior |wait_for_completion |wait_for_common |schedule_timeout I guess usb async resume/suspend are disordered,So I try to disable. After that,we tested the case for a month,the bug never happened again. the fn device_enable_async_suspend set the dev->power.async_suspend= 1. dev->power.async_suspend=1&pm_async_enabled=1,fork task like 365 ---> dpm_resume |dpm_async_fn |async_resume dev->power.async_suspend=0,disable async --->dpm_resume |device_resume |call device resume fn. here is a demo: Only few devices such as scsi/pci/usb call device_enable_async_suspend. but scsi call device_disable_async_suspend at drivers/scsi/hosts.c Signed-off-by: weihui zhang --- drivers/usb/core/hub.c | 2 +- drivers/usb/core/port.c | 2 +- 2 files chang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-) diff --git a/drivers/usb/core/hub.c b/drivers/usb/core/hub.c index e38a4124f..de74f70e5 100644 --- a/drivers/usb/core/hub.c +++ b/drivers/usb/core/hub.c @@ -2602,7 +2602,7 @@ int usb_new_device(struct usb_device *udev) add_device_randomness(udev->manufacturer, strlen(udev->manufacturer)); - device_enable_async_suspend(&udev->dev); + device_disable_async_suspend(&udev->dev); /* check whether the hub or firmware marks this port as non-removable */ set_usb_port_removable(udev); diff --git a/drivers/usb/core/port.c b/drivers/usb/core/port.c index c628c1abc..97696c415 100644 --- a/drivers/usb/core/port.c +++ b/drivers/usb/core/port.c @@ -760,7 +760,7 @@ int usb_hub_create_port_device(struct usb_hub *hub, int port1) pm_runtime_set_active(&port_dev->dev); pm_runtime_get_noresume(&port_dev->dev); pm_runtime_enable(&port_dev->dev); - device_enable_async_suspend(&port_dev->dev); + device_disable_async_suspend(&port_dev->dev); /* * Keep hidden the ability to enable port-poweroff if the hub
